Output 5ecbaa252bca230733d6ac5691765f79e45e5ac1e8a0da3c1f5399c696a7f23a:3

value
3890
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c9680fa843dc070e470bce1fe292752a9ef612d3d1337f6d1661a6e179899852
address
bc1pe95ql2zrmsrsu3ctec079yn49200vykn6yeh7mgkvxnwz7vfnpfq5qx7wf
transaction
5ecbaa252bca230733d6ac5691765f79e45e5ac1e8a0da3c1f5399c696a7f23a
spent
true